The UK And The Netherlands Are Building Europe’s Biggest Cross-border Electricity Link

‘LionLink’ will connect the UK to a Dutch offshore wind farm. An undersea cable will transport up to 1.8GW of electricity between the two countries. That’s enough to power 2 of the UK’s biggest cities, Birmingham and Manchester. Interconnectors boost energy security by reducing the need to import fossil fuels This has become a priority for Europe since Russia’s invasion of Ukraine, after which Russia cut its natural gas supplies to the Europe by 80%. Interconnectors also help to resolve one of the biggest challenges of renewable energy, intermittency.
